I have an A2Z tool post I purchased years age and want to buy more tool holders for it, but don't know what kind to get to fit it. I purchased an Accusize 250-002 from Amazon thinking it would fit, but it doesn't. Anyone here know where to get them? I'm using it on a small Craftsman model maker's lathe.
 
Little Machine Shop still lists them although it looks like they're on backorder.
 
Well, that's strange. I searched for A2Z there the other day and nothing came up.
I believe that, possibly because they no longer carry the actual tool posts but they do still list holders that will fit. At least that’s my best guess. I have the same tool post although I rarely use it anymore, I also made my own extra holders a while back. Weren’t that difficult, but a you do kind of need a milling machine or a shaper for the dovetail part.

Here are some dimensions from the LMS OXA QCTP and Holder. If the dimensions of your A2Z QCTP and Holders are similar you should be able to order the LMS OXA holders.
IMG_7113 2.jpgIMG_7114.JPG
 
Yeah, the A2Z dimensions are just enough off to stop you from sourcing "common" holders...Dovetail 0.948” inside, 1.130” widest
 
I guess I'll either wait for Little Machine shop to get them in again, or wait till I get my Bridgeport and make them.
